Why Do Eyelids Begin to Droop?

The skin around the eyes is the thinnest on the body, making it especially susceptible to aging.

Over time, several changes occur:

  • Collagen and elastin production decline.
  • Skin loses firmness and elasticity.
  • Fat pads shift or shrink.
  • Muscles around the eyes weaken.
  • Gravity causes tissues to descend.

These changes can result in:

  • Hooded upper eyelids
  • Loose eyelid skin
  • A tired appearance
  • Fine lines and crow's feet
  • Reduced upper eyelid definition
  • A less open, youthful appearance

For some individuals, excess upper eyelid skin can even interfere with the upper field of vision.

Do You Always Need Eyelid Surgery?

Not necessarily.

Traditional upper eyelid surgery (blepharoplasty) remains an excellent option for patients with significant excess skin or advanced aging. However, many people with mild to moderate eyelid changes can benefit from less invasive procedures that require less downtime and avoid general anesthesia.

The best treatment depends on:

  • Your age
  • Skin quality
  • Degree of eyelid laxity
  • Brow position
  • Facial anatomy
  • Cosmetic goals

ZipLyft™: A Modern, Minimally Invasive Upper Eyelid Lift

One of the newest innovations in eyelid rejuvenation is ZipLyft™, a minimally invasive upper eyelid lift performed in the office under local anesthesia.

Unlike traditional blepharoplasty, ZipLyft™ uses proprietary Compression Skin Contouring (CoCo™) technology to remove excess upper eyelid skin through a streamlined technique. The procedure is designed to minimize bleeding and uses medical adhesive instead of traditional stitches for closure.

Benefits of ZipLyft™ include:

  • More open, refreshed-looking eyes
  • Reduction of excess upper eyelid skin
  • Office-based procedure
  • Local anesthesia
  • No traditional sutures
  • Minimal downtime for many patients
  • Natural-looking results

ZipLyft™ may be an excellent option for patients with mild to moderate upper eyelid skin laxity who want noticeable improvement without a more extensive surgical procedure.

Sofwave® for Brow Lifting

Sometimes the problem isn't only the eyelids—it is the position of the eyebrows.

As the brows gradually descend with age, they can make the upper eyelids appear heavier.

Sofwave® uses advanced ultrasound technology to stimulate collagen production beneath the skin, helping lift the brow area and improve mild skin laxity without surgery.

Many patients notice:

  • A subtle brow lift
  • Brighter-looking eyes
  • Firmer skin
  • Smoother forehead
  • Improved upper facial appearance

Because Sofwave® is completely non-invasive, there is virtually no downtime.

RF Microneedling Around the Eyes

RF Microneedling combines tiny needles with radiofrequency energy to stimulate collagen and elastin production.

Around the eyes, this treatment may improve:

  • Fine lines
  • Crepey skin
  • Mild skin laxity
  • Skin texture
  • Overall skin quality

While RF Microneedling is not intended to remove significant excess eyelid skin, it can complement other eyelid rejuvenation treatments by improving the quality and firmness of the surrounding skin.

Neuromodulators Can Create a Subtle Eye Lift

Botox®, Daxxify®, and other neuromodulators are well known for smoothing wrinkles, but they can also create a subtle lifting effect.

Strategic placement around the outer eyebrows can:

  • Lift the tail of the brow
  • Open the eyes
  • Improve brow symmetry
  • Reduce crow's feet

Results typically appear within one to two weeks and last several months.

Dermal Fillers Can Refresh the Eye Area

Sometimes tired-looking eyes are caused less by loose skin and more by volume loss.

Carefully placed dermal fillers can improve:

  • Hollow under-eye areas
  • Tear troughs
  • Upper cheek support
  • Overall facial balance

Restoring volume beneath the eyes can create a more youthful, rested appearance without changing your natural features.

Laser Skin Rejuvenation

Laser treatments stimulate collagen production while improving:

  • Fine lines
  • Sun damage
  • Skin texture
  • Pigmentation
  • Mild skin laxity

Laser resurfacing is often combined with RF Microneedling or other collagen-stimulating treatments for comprehensive facial rejuvenation.
